Eri Hozumi and Mariia Kozyreva meet in the opening round of qualifying for the 2026 Memphis Classic, a new WTA 250 event on outdoor hard courts at the Leftwich Tennis Center. Both players focus primarily on doubles, where Hozumi holds a career-high ranking of No. 27 and current standing near No. 66, while Kozyreva sits at No. 63 after multiple WTA 125 titles. Hozumi, at 32, offers greater overall experience including prior Grand Slam appearances, though her recent singles activity remains limited. Kozyreva, 27, has shown stronger recent momentum in doubles and enters with a singles ranking around No. 619. The hard-court surface favors baseline consistency, and the outcome will determine advancement into the main-draw qualifying draw amid a packed early-week schedule.
